Smart Planning: Practical Tips for Visiting and Saving on Your Trip

To make the most of your travel expo experience, a bit of preparation is key. While most domestic travel expos charge a small fee for on-site entry, many offer opportunities for free admission through online pre-registration or by engaging with the organizers' official channels (e.g., following their social media). It's wise to check the official expo website beforehand to understand how to secure free entry. Once at the expo, the bustling environment and complex layouts can make it easy to get lost or miss crucial information. Therefore, review the expo map and booth layout from the official website in advance, and mark down any regions or events that interest you to create an efficient viewing plan. Furthermore, the various prize draws and participation events held at the expo are excellent chances to save on future travel expenses or snag some unique souvenirs. Actively engage with these events to enrich your expo visit. Don't forget to wear comfortable shoes and bring a small notebook and pen for jotting down valuable tips.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q. When and where do domestic travel expos typically take place in the U.S.?
A. Domestic travel expos are usually held annually, often in late winter or early spring, at major convention centers across large U.S. cities. Specific dates and locations vary each year, so checking the official website of the expo you wish to attend is the most accurate way to get current information.
Q. Is there usually an entrance fee for these expos, and can I get in for free?
A. While there's often a nominal fee for on-site ticket purchases, many expos offer free admission opportunities. These can include online pre-registration, downloading the official app, or following the organizer's social media channels. It's always a good idea to check their website before attending for free entry options.
